Lwc Datatable Checkbox - How to display a checkbox field using lightning.

Last updated:

Example of lightning-datatable inline to edit/save rows of records and refresh lwc component on click button in Salesforce Lightning Web Component — LWC | Inline Edit/Save Field and refresh the component after successful save of standard record page in Salesforce LWC 14 views; How to convert date format Using …. Let's say you have an attribute called currentSelectedRows which will be defaulted to an empty array. The answer mentioned above would work perfectly fine. Hot Network Questions How to expand a volume group from a single physical volume. gurrs and purrs rescue yelm Jul 13, 2022 · You must have set the column type as text and passing the boolean value to it, which will display as literals 'true' or 'false'. Medicine Matters Sharing successes, challenges and daily happenings in the Department of Medicine National Doctors’ Day falls on March 30 annually to recognize the contributions of. Step 2 : Create a new component which extends datatable. name: 'Edit first row name object'. LWC for Mobile; Embedded Services SDK; AppExchange; Security; Identity; Lightning Design System; datatable. how to set height of icon in lwc datatable or lightning tree grid. Here am trying to select and deselect the checkboxes for the first two row, which unfortunately seems frozen and doesn't allow me check. To display Salesforce data in a table, use the lightning-datatable component. In this case it is simply counting the number of selected rows. The lightning-tree-grid component is built on lightning-datatable and supports a subset of its features. old nwa wrestling Currently, I have added lightning-datatable's checkbox option as well for update selected rows as bulk using the button. filter (comparer (oldData)); var onlyInOld = oldData. prop('disabled', true); var myTable = $('#mytable'). Aug 20, 2020 · Based upon the picklist value, am displaying the records using LWC dataTable. For the table display, we have used a standard lighting data table to display the table and fetched the record IDs of particular rows selected and stored them in an attribute that showed a count of selected records, and before deleting the selected rows shown the modal that asks for confirmation. We have a key-field attribute in lightning-datatable tag which is unique for every row in the table and based on this field only we can populate pre selected …. How to vertically center LWC lightning-button icons to the button text. Multi Select Combobox component is advance then dual-listbox because this cover small space and dual cover big space. You don't have to use the query-selector, nor child. Define a function that creates and returns a checkbox. Rows that contain nested data display a chevron icon ( >) to denote that they can be expanded or collapsed. let advanceFilterCheckbox =this. The Page 1 Checkboxes are pre selected as below, Page 2 other any other pages checkboxes are not selected. LWC Combobox Picklist : Get Pick-list Values (With / Without Default Record Type Id) Navigate/Redirect To Record Page Based On Record Id In LWC (Lightning Web Component) LWC Data Table With …. I display a list of opportunity and add a hyperlink on the column name of the data table. Best way to code in salesforce & download source code. Rapidly develop apps with our responsive, reusable. Extend the standard lightning datatable in a custom datatable component. Without "render", true or false is displayed. LWC lightning-datatable with checkbox selection. Key features and capabilities: Out-of-the-box Functionalities: Includes sorting, column resizing, and inline editing. LWC add custom data-type checkbox and extending lightning-datatable - Salesforce Stack Exchange. querySelectorAll('[data-advance-filter = "checkbox"]'); advanceFilterCheckbox. In a Salesforce LWC app how can I add checkbox values to an object's field and show it in a data-table? Asked 1 year, 6 months ago. Assuming your c-icrm-rich-datatable is extending the lightning-datatable component, the columns and actions property needs to look like this:. I am currently trying to implement a filter menu dropdown with multi-select checkboxes. I have a checkbox select column and I am trying to show/hide the checkbox (allow row selection) based on the value in column 6. Each object describes the changed values by. As a simple demonstration to this, consider the following code: let x = new Proxy({}, { get() { return 'Hello World'; } }); console. So, here I am posting the lightning datatable which supports lookup and picklist fields in edit mode and row selection …. This example has been copied from official link. I was Experimenting with lightning:datatable, trying to delete multiple records using checkbox. end initialisation parameter, which works just the same as fixedColumns. The selected Ids will be send to the system by clicking the Deactivate Users button. Nested for:each Loop to render Data in LWC. Part 4 : Use a Datatable to inline edit a group of records. Check out our collection of articles about the field of oceanography at HowStuffWorks. fx if my html datatable looks something like this: <div if:. Related sample: Custom Checkbox and Radio in DataTable. This will allow you to directly access properties from a constant vs having to query your DOM. List; List Views The Kanban View Reports and Dashboards Search for Records What About Salesforce Classic? Meet the Switcher; Load or Update Records with the Custom Metadata Loader; Logged In UserId; LWC; LWC and Aura Communication; lwc basic knowledge; LWC Communication; …. In multiselect we create pills so you can remove easily on pills. Required fields are marked * Name * Email * Website Commen. data: The array of data to be displayed. When I ran your code as-is, I got the UNCHECKED values in the OnlyInNew variable and the CHECKED values in the onlyInOld. I want the checkbox to be disable when the status is "Closed". I have a requirement where I have implemented the lightning-dataTable with the custom-dataType column checkbox. Check the spelling of your keywords. Few things are more exciting for a travel editor than the opportunity. We can still query for it in the DOM and dispatch an event from it to invoke the change handler we wired up to it. When I reload my record page, where my lwc is placed,only then I am able to see the updated table. Two-way data binding can also be used with other types of UI elements, such as checkboxes, radio …. I'm building an LWC to be used in Record Page and Community, a custom related records list component, that shows formula fields properly formatted (rich-text formatted), so it uses targetConfigs {data} columns={columns} hide-checkbox-column="true"> JS Controller import …. We also showed how to use custom data types with the Lightning Datatable component. If it’s a checkbox that is checked/unchecked we process the logic in the if block. opportunityList))}"> I have a datatable in the lwc and want do display a message when no data to display Here my code: HTML:. I have a simple lightning-datatable in a lwc component. data={searchResults} columns={searchResultColumns} draft-values={draftValues} oncellchange={handleChangedQuantity} onrowaction={handleSearchResultRowAction}. To use the standard layout, specify standardCellLayout: true when you define your custom types. I cannot use a lightning data-table in this case, since what I want is a radio button selection, not a checkbox selection. The full Editor reference documentation is available to registered users of Editor - the information shown below is a summary only. You may also be able to read the values directly, as in: this. Create a lightning datatable in LWC from scratch. Add Buttons In LWC Datatable Salesforce. And as the world slowly emerges from the global pandemic,. The data storage that feeds your can contain, and often does contain, elements you choose not to display. Jul 1, 2022 · LWC add custom data-type checkbox and extending lightning-datatable - Salesforce Stack Exchange. I want to disabled a button on a lightning datatable based on a boolean field, I came to this solution: const columns = [ { label: 'Client', type:'button', typeAttributes: { label: 'Client', disabled: {fieldName: 'Client__c' } } } ]; lwc; or ask your own question. How to hide checkbox in lightning data table? This example creates a table whose first column displays a checkbox for row selection. columns={columnsData} onrowaction={handleDelete} hide-checkbox-column show-row-number-column> lightning-web-components. Also check this: Display Maps in Lightning Web Component Salesforce. The drive belt on your Chevrolet Prizm is a single, continuous belt that works its way through a number of pulleys that drive the alternator, the air conditioning pump and other co. Finding the right details of the right record is an integral part of any business, and you want it to be quick! This solution allows you to see the details of the selected recording in the LWC with much ease. It looks same as lightning-datatable since it implements lightning-datatable internally. Details are explained in code comment. Indices Commodities Currencies Stocks. start does for the start of the table. What we'll learn in this video - 1. import LightningDatatable from 'lightning/datatable'; import clickModal from …. lightning-checkbox-group display horizontally. I could use Tree Grid but I also want to display the column headers for the line items which tree grid does not do. I am trying to change the text color in a lightning data table (LWC), and I'm not having any luck. Oct 8, 2021 · I have created a salesforce standard lightning data table in which i am trying to restrict the user to select only one row it is working as per the requirement when user select the particular row in the data section , but when user select the checkbox on the header then it is not behaving properly outcome in that scenario is except first. Apply infinite loading, selecting rows programmatically, add dynamic row level actions. Furthermore, as the hidden data is still part of the table, it can still, optionally, be. These are then stored in a Account record variable in the flow. When I edit the data and hit on save , the data table doesn't refresh automatically and the cell value remains the same although the record gets updated. pictureurl field holds the url of the images. Lightning datatable tag is same as lightning:datatable tag in aura. LWC Data Table With Checkbox Example. Here I am creating lwc datatable with sorting the columns of Account Object by ascending and descending order in lightning web component (LWC). Once the user has tabbed out of the grid, tabbing back into the grid will return focus to the last cell the user was focused on. In this example, the value attribute of the lightning-input element is bound to the name property using two-way data binding. DataTable dt = new DataTable("UserAcess"); DataColumn dc1 = new DataColumn("PageName"); dt. In this example, I will use account records to achieve this requirement, but you can use any salesforce sobject to perform this action. I wrote a simple example of how one might accomplish this. Enables programmatic row selection with a list of key-field values. . This will be rendered inside individual cells in datatable. I believe on your page load you need to trigger checkbox to be ticked. How to toggle disabled property from button if it's row has been selected. But in breaking news situations, even young adults look. Validation in lightning-datatable in Salesforce LWC Home InfallibleTechie Admin December 14, 2020 September 15, 2023 December 14, 2020 September 15, 2023 InfallibleTechie Admin. Since you are using the select extension and the checkbox is supposed to work along with that, you really not need to provide a checkbox yourself. This component supports the following input types: The following HTML input types are not supported. Here we can keep selected records by paginating the data. Afterwards I just selected the Contacts which I need to generate the Requests and when I click the Button the datatable will looks like below, In the above datatable I'll need to disable the Test Contact 2 row to select because its status is Pending. nordstrom trend show 2022 Normal update I am able to do but once I edited the fields for multiple rows and then I wants to select some row using checkbox on ligtningDataTable to keep the changes and get updated on click of save button but if no …. data: "ST", searchable: false,. Let’s see a simple example to show content based on the selection of checkbox. Tab character (\t) doesn't render in the lightning datatable in …. I have a DataTables with a checkbox column on the 1st column of the DataTables, I need to get the data value of checked row, so for example: checkBox simsPid ICCID IMEI ----- ----- ----- ----- - 1 18789 AABBC x 2 18729 A3B4C5 I need to get the data values of checked row (in my use case above, I need to get simsPid, ICCID, and IMEI). var selectedRows = client_table. You'd need in your component to create a new field to store the selected Ids, and prepopulate it at load time with the Ids of all of your. I have two LWC created for each page. Key Highlights : Filter the data by search box. . We can create a reusable and configurable data table component. Though cursor is not allowed, it still clickable and selects all records. How to set order of execution for getter/setter in LWC. Here we will show the buttons in one column so users can perform different types of actions like edit, delete, and view records. Eg: If I select 1st checkbox and shift select 5th checkbox, then the first five checkboxes must be checked. This blog will create a generic data table component that has a below. The Western world is feverish. Expert Advice On Improving Your Home All Projects. data} columns={columns} key-field="Name"> apex; lightning-web …. Lightning DataTable With Row Actions in Lightning Web Component(lwc) This post explains how to handle row actions in the lightning data table in lightning web components(lwc) Example:. Use lightning:button instead for input types button, reset, and submit. Achieving Custom Picklist Editing. I wish to control the height of a datatable based on the number of records present. We will build a paginated view of the standard contact records in salesforce. Use the lightning-record-edit-form component to create a form that's used to add a Salesforce record or update fields in an existing record on an object. querySelector('lightning-datatable'). This is where i am not able to find a solution how to filter the datatable based on the action of …. querySelector and then access the rows attribute. checked to find if it’s checked or not. This is a generic lighting datatable, which is built in LWC. Customizable Columns: Allows custom cell formatting, including buttons, links, and other actions. So, assuming your column name is 'IsChecked', the column should be defined in LWC as follows: { label: 'IsChecked', fieldName: 'IsChecked', type: 'Boolean' } This will make the column get rendered with checkbox. I tried adding a disabled attribute to the object data when it was loaded in my helper: var responseValues = response. This selector worked fine until I added the datatable-checkboxes library to this React class. Datatable LWC tbody in another component. I have an assignment to update a checkbox on multiple records on a lightning web component datatable. You need to check weather the checkboxes selected or not as per your requirement, Condition 1: if question selected length is more than 1, then disable the YTA condition 2: if YTA is selected then disable all the Questions. When the type of column for the data table is URL, Fields with Datatype URL are displayed as Links by default. This example creates a table whose first column displays a checkbox for row selection. Use lightning:radioGroup instead of input type radio for radio buttons. The result is that as soon as the first 'B' option appears, the entire table disables clicking the checkbox of every row, no matter if it is 'A' or 'B', and clicking the 'Select All' button still works and checks everything, even the 'B' row, when it shouldn't. Is there any way to make actions open to the right? type: 'action', typeAttributes: { rowActions: actions. Make the custom type editable in the column definition. Challenges with Out-of-the-Box (OOB) Datatable The lighting-datatable component proficiently displays tabular data, allowing column customization based on data types. Update your import statement as below. Boolean attributes on standard HTML Elements are set to true by adding the attribute to the element. I have been trying so long to solve this issue. Based on your question and markup, I believe that you intend to iterate through each table row element, and get the status of the checkbox in each row. Mac only: If you're not a big fan of using the Terminal but love hidden features in OS X, Secrets is the preference pane for you. The Select extension's documentation describes the checkbox selection options in detail, but please note that support is automatic for …. Out of 3 records, I deleted 1st record and after it was deleted, the checkbox remained checked for the 2nd record. How can we know that there is a click that happens? Help me. How can I clear the checkbox after deletion? I checked here. Modified 2 years, 4 months ago. However a major limitation of this is that it only seems to fire when the user clicks away from the inline-edit input field (blur). Oct 7, 2020 · But If you want to allow only 1 checkbox to be checked and the rest N-1 checkboxes to be automatically unchecked you can simplify and replace the whole code by the next two lines: const boxes = this. So, here I am posting the lightning datatable which supports lookup and picklist fields in edit mode and row selection consistency along with the pagination. To make your custom data type editable in lightning-datatable, create an additional template to implement the UI for inline editing of the data type. setCustomValidity() working only on first row of dynamic table lightning. 313 powell st brooklyn ny 11212 Click event for URL column in Lightning-Datatable. Lines 44-52 duplicated for the other checkbox column, but have a unique class for the checkboxes in each column. So when the selected row event fires you can get the difference of newly selected rows and old selected rows like this. So if we go on the same page again by pagination we can see selected records. stater bros pick up Here is the process to implement the Datatable with Infinite or lazy loading to show the large set of Account Invoice data using GraphQL wire adapter, with Remote Sort and Remote Search. Who should I contact to get it back?. Secrets provides a list of hidden features (and de. In regards to hiding the rows with banned class on the page load you could put the following code on your page load possibly and see if that does the trick. cheap cigarettes in missouri render-config: global: Enables and configures advanced rendering modes. Hi Alex, The issue here is that the checkbox shown by Select is not a real checkbox. data(); This is going to return selected rows even if you have selected multiple rows in different pages. for the unchecked radio button. This is not possible with the standard data table component. Lightning Web Component lightning-datatable in lwc. I had the hideCheckboxColumn="false" but didn't see any checkboxes. moberly newspaper Single Selection LWC Lightning Datatable. However, it does not explicitly show how to select all of the rows for a Data-table. Using: According to the lwc datatable documentation: Radio buttons are used when maxRowSelection is 1. Pagination as First, Previous, Next and Last buttons. When a user selects or deselects the checkbox. I have created a Custom Inline editable table in LWC. sorted-by: text: false: : The column fieldName that controls the. Disable one of the checkbox in lightning-checkbox-group in LWC. → lightning-tree-grid have one extra functionality that each row in the table can be expanded to reveal a nested group of items. Therefore, the default value of an attribute is always false. There are 2 components so child is main and parent where we get selected options. Show records for both custom and standard objects. About; Products show and hide columns in Datatable upon checkbox selection. Add a comment | 2 LWC add custom data-type checkbox and extending lightning-datatable. gosu manga How can I set the maximum height of this button, or of the entire row? This is the definition of the datatable: grinch hairdos I have LWC component with 10 Account Records with checkbox and …. reset-lightning-input-fields-in-lwc-output-techdicer. For example: used vans for sale on craigslist @AuraEnabled (cacheable=true) public static List retrieveAccounts(){. When you press the Tab key or click outside the cell after making changes, the datatable footer appears with the Cancel and Save buttons. heather childers hot The template is referencing a new lwc that will do the display and events of the cell. Eric Strausman Eric Strausman Stock mar. Old: Out of the box component doesn't support booleans as checkboxes in the standard data types, the supported data types currently are: action; button; currency; date; email; location; number; percent; phone; text; url; These can be found under the "Formatting with Data Types" section on the Lightning datatables reference. Now the requirement is we need show child record using accordion feature. Lightning datatable provides an onsort attribute that allows us to implement the sorting in lightning datatable. I have an LWC component with 10 Account Records with a checkbox and submit button. Wondering, "Where can I load my Chime Card?" We list your fee-free, in-person, and online options for adding money. Jan 28, 2022 · But instead of starting with 0 I would need to start with the initial value for checked checkboxes (on response). I am using lightning-datatable to display a set of data. Also check this: Notifications with New Alert, Confirm, and Prompt in LWC. So I have need to support both checkbox selection per row as well as selecting the row itself. Hi, I just found in legacy documentation that there is a equivalence of dt. Of course, you can updateRecord right from the LWC, but I think it works slower if you want to update multiple records at once so I added a simple apex method. Building an efficient LWC form without record-edit-form. The Laravel Datatables package escapes the content of all columns by default – except for action column. The only other option I can think of is to set the DataTable's hideCheckboxColumn attribute to true. Custom Data table in LWC is a solution to a lot of things. Add Custom Labels to Supported Fields on a FlexCard. Creating a custom cell type, add inline editing for the same. escambia sheriff dispatched calls We will build a paginated view of the standard …. According to this documentation, we can select rows programmatically. Lightning datatable header scrolls along with values in my LWC. We have an application where we need checkbox to appear in only the top level record of tree-grid, and not the subsequent children. The following are recordInput properties:. The Component Library is the Lightning components developer reference. This example shows a column with checkboxes that are always displayed and will cause a database update when their state is toggled via a click or keyboard action. Get ratings and reviews for the top 11 pest companies in New Baltimore, MI. Now click on install and wait until it finishes. This blog will just restrict single row selection with checkbox in lightning-datatable. Jun 7, 2020 · I am currently trying to implement a filter menu dropdown with multi-select checkboxes. Hide vertical scrollbar in lwc lightning datatable. I want to add the checkbox in DataTable and the bind ti grid view. Final Output || To find Source Code Link, Click Here. If I select 3 records,R1,R2,R3, it is duplicating like R1R1R2R1R2R3, How to remove this diplicate. In the section "columns: []" I used a "render" to get a checkbox object but it does not refer to the data field. Learn how to refresh the data of a lightning datatable in LWC after creating a new record. Mass Delete Records in LWC Datatable. Selecting the checkbox selects the entire row of data and triggers the onrowselection event handler.